had a recurring one from a car wreck. go see an oral surgeon or ent. they have to remove it in tact. can't eat normal for 3 days. not too painful. just more annoying than anything.
ETA: i would lance it myself but they kept coming back. not immediately but anywhere from 6 months to 2 years later.
mine was a mucocele. it was below the skin, not on top like the pic you posted.

les, you may have had an oral fibroma. just a little bit different.
op, these are easily removed under local by an ent. if you just unroof it (bite it off yourself) chances are you've left some of the cyst wall behind and it could return.
